RNLI Rye Harbour had a busy day on Sunday, October 15. The day began with training
first thing with lots of modules taken and passed. The crew is dedicated and committed, putting many hours of their daily lives into their modules which they have to pass to keep up-to-date with world-class training from the RNLI. They are volunteers and are give up many family moments and events to be on call.

This was followed by Mark Stephenson manning a stall at Rye fire station’s open day with lots of people attending. A shout followed at 1:16pm to a yacht aground opposite the oil refinery in the river. The Atlantic 85 was soon on the scene, enabling the owners to take their yacht to safety. There are no weekends off for our crew on the boat and on the shore –  just 24/7 commitment and dedication.
